Output 8374ce1b3c4c6c18548c26166c8f971cc4e92e2ebdc78188ccc3d60411917055:5

value
535795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 022efbccd0c27fbd5c8760b01527b7bd415c2534 OP_EQUAL
address
31tZZQRrCdkQEtszDbs17y3xsDnpBxirmE
transaction
8374ce1b3c4c6c18548c26166c8f971cc4e92e2ebdc78188ccc3d60411917055
confirmations
242385
spent
true